When a switchboard is repaired or remodeled in a power station and a substation, VCT combination test and voltage matching test are performed. This test measures phase difference of voltages and currents between a reference point and a comparison point. In this test, 2 measurement points are connected to one measurement device by long, heavy and plural cables to transfer voltage and current signals. This is to secure simultaneity. (See Fig.1)
"Cordless VCT combination test system (CVE-27)" is a solution without long, heavy and plural cables for VCT combination test and voltage matching test. The following is an overview of this system: 2 measurement units are set to both a reference point and a comparison point, and "very accurate" internal clock in these units are used to secure simultaneity. After that, measurement units send measurement data to Control unit (Notebook computer) via wireless LAN and/or mobile phone. Then Microsoft Excel displays measurement result on Control unit. We developed "Cordless VCT combination test system (CVE-27)" with Sendai technical center of Tohoku Electric Power Co., Inc. in fiscal 2010. Advantages of this system are to save engineer resource and avoid human error in a VCT combination test and a voltage matching test.
Error of internal clock is 10usec or lower (i.e. 0.2 degree or lower). This is enough performance for VCT combination test and voltage matching test.
If there are some barriers for wireless LAN like a test between difference floors (See Fig.3), wireless LAN repeater can extend communication range. This system includes battery box for wireless LAN access point and repeater. You can put wireless LAN access point and repeater easily on some places without considering outlet.
If you want to perform long distance test (for example, a comparison substation is far from reference power station), it is unable to perform VCT combination test and voltage matching test by usual method with cables. "Cordless VCT Combination Test System (CVE-27)" is a solution of this case.
In case of long distance test, GPS sets internal clocks in 2 measurement units to standard time. Then wireless LAN and mobile phone are used to transfer measurement data.
2 measurement units measure voltage and current RMS and phase at same time and send measurement data to control unit automatically. Then control unit inputs them to Excel worksheet and display them (See left figure). So you don't need to write down data and input it to computer by hand.
In left figure, the red cell means a standard phase. You can move it by clicking other cell simply. If you have already had your own Excel worksheet for VCT combination test and voltage matching test, you can use cell-link method of Excel. I.e. you set cell link between Excel worksheet of CVE27 and your Excel worksheet before test. Then after measurement finishes, CVE27 opens own worksheet. At this time, Excel link sends data to your worksheet automatically. So you can see measurement data on your own worksheet immediately.

Current: Three-phase alternating current ... 4 items consist of three phases(R-S-T) and neutral
Voltage: Three-phase alternating voltage ... 6 items consist of phase voltages(R-N, S-N, T-N) and line voltages(R-S, S-T, T-R)
RMS | Phase | ||||
---|---|---|---|---|---|
Range | Accuracy※ | Range | Error | ||
Current | 1 to 20A | +- 1.0% | 0 to 360degree | +- 3degree | |
0.1 to 1A | +- 1.0% | ||||
0.003 to 0.1A | +- 1.5% | ||||
Voltage | Phase voltage | 10 to 150V | +- 1.0% | 0 to 360degree | +- 3degree |
Note: Standard of calculation is a full scale value. (((Measured value - Full scale value)/ full scale value) * 100)
Range is changed automatically. (There is no manual mode)
Current: Via clamp sensor
Voltage: Direct input to terminals
Control unit: AC100V 65W or build-in battery of notebook computer
Measurement unit: AC100V 50W or 12 C-size NiMH batteries (Unit works about 1.5 hours with batteries)
Wireless LAN access point: 5 AA-size NiMH batteries (Access point works about 2 hours with batteries)
2 Wireless LANs (short distance test)
One wireless LAN and one mobile phone (long distance test)
